How Our Water Damage Restoration Process Works
With water damage restoration, our team follows a strict process that ensures your property is restored to its original state. We start by assessing the damage and identifying the sources of the water, then use specialized equipment to extract the water and dry out the affected areas. This process is critical, as it helps prevent further damage and reduces the risk of mold growth.

Floor Water Damage Restoration Cost In Stokesdale, NC
The cost of floor water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Stokesdale, NC.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The cost of water extraction depends on the amount of water and the equipment needed to extract it. |
| Mold Remediation | $1,000 – $5,000 | The cost of mold remediation depends on the size of the affected area and the extent of the mold growth.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| The cost of drying and dehumidification depends on the size of the affected area and the equipment needed to dry it out. |
| Final Inspection and Cleanup | $500 – $1,000 | The cost of final inspection and cleanup depends on the size of the affected area and the extent of the damage. |
